Frequently asked questions about Sedalia Middle School
How many students attend Sedalia Middle School?
Sedalia Middle School has 396 students enrolled. It is an elementary school in Sedalia, MO. CCD year-over-year: 384 (2022-23) → 351 (2023-24), down 33.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Sedalia Middle School?
The student-teacher ratio at Sedalia Middle School is 14.1:1, which is 10% higher than the Missouri average of 12.8:1 and 10% lower than the national average of 15.7:1.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Sedalia Middle School?
54.9% of students at Sedalia Middle School are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Missouri average of 46.1%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Sedalia Middle School?
The largest demographic group at Sedalia Middle School is White at 67.9% of enrollment, in Sedalia, MO.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Sedalia Middle School?
Sedalia Middle School has a Resource Investment Index of 49/100 (higher re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
How does Sedalia Middle School rank among elementary schools in Sedalia?
By Resource Investment Index, Sedalia Middle School ranks #3 of 6 elementary schools in Sedalia, MO. This compares federal resource and staffing data among local peers; it is not a test-score or academic ranking. See all elementary schools in Sedalia on the city page.
